Understanding the Swedish Driving License System
Sweden issues driving licenses through the Transport Agency (Transportstyrelsen), which oversees all matters associated with chauffeur qualification and roadway security. The Swedish driving license is acknowledged throughout all European Union member states and many other countries, making it a valuable file for anybody preparation to travel or live within Europe. Unlike some nations where the testing process might be fairly simple, Sweden positions considerable emphasis on guaranteeing that every licensed motorist has not only the technical abilities to run a lorry but also a deep understanding of traffic guidelines, danger perception, and accountable driving habits.
The minimum age for obtaining a Swedish driving license for traveler cars (classification B) is eighteen years, though people can start the knowing procedure at sixteen. This early start allows aspiring chauffeurs to complete theoretical training and accumulate the required practice hours before they become eligible to take the useful assessment. Eligibility Requirements and Necessary Documentation
Before embarking on the journey toward a Swedish driving license, candidates need to guarantee they meet the basic eligibility requirements. Primarily, applicants must possess a legitimate Swedish individuality number (personnummer) or, in specific cases, a coordination number. This identification is essential for registering with the Transport Agency and tracking progress through the licensing process.
Medical fitness is another vital requirement that can not be overlooked. Prospects must finish a medical checkup carried out by an authorized healthcare company, ensuring they do not have conditions that could impair their ability to drive safely. This examination consists of vision testing and a general health evaluation. People with certain medical conditions might still be eligible for a license but might be based on additional requirements or limitations.
Paperwork required for the application procedure includes proof of identity, the finished medical assessment certificate, and proof of having actually finished the obligatory theoretical and practical training. Photocard recognition is basic for the license itself, so candidates need to guarantee they have appropriate documents for this purpose also.
The Step-by-Step Process
The path to a Swedish driving license follows a structured sequence that prospects need to finish in order. Understanding this progression assists striving drivers prepare mentally and economically for what lies ahead.
The journey starts with enrolling at a qualified driving school (trafikskola ), where prospects receive their student authorization and begin theoretical guideline. This preliminary phase covers traffic guidelines, roadway signs, lorry mechanics, and the mental elements of responsible driving. The theoretical element is not merely scholastic; it establishes the structure upon which useful skills are developed. A lot of driving schools in Sweden need prospects to finish a minimum number of theoretical lessons before proceeding to useful training.
Following the theoretical structure, candidates move on to hands-on driving practice with a certified instructor. The Swedish system mandates a particular variety of mandatory lessons, that include training in numerous driving conditions such as night driving, highway driving, and winter season conditions when appropriate. These structured lessons make sure that brand-new chauffeurs experience a varied range of scenarios before they try the useful assessment.
Before taking the practical driving test, candidates should pass a theoretical evaluation (kunskapsprov) that checks their understanding of traffic rules, roadway signs, and safe driving principles. This computer-based test consists of seventy concerns and should be completed within around fifty minutes. A passing rating needs correct answers to a minimum of fifty-two questions, demonstrating a detailed understanding of the theoretical product.
Upon successfully passing the theoretical assessment, prospects end up being qualified to schedule their useful driving test (körprov). This test assesses the prospect's capability to operate a lorry securely in genuine traffic conditions, including maneuvers such as parking, reversing, and browsing intersections. The inspector examines not only technical efficiency however also the prospect's ability to anticipate risks and make proper decisions.
Categories and Types of Swedish Driving Licenses
Swedish driving licenses are categorized according to the kind of car the holder is licensed to operate. Understanding these categories assists prospects choose the proper license for their requirements.
| License Category | Lorry Type | Minimum Age | Notes |
|---|---|---|---|
| AM | Moped | 15 | 2 or three-wheeled automobiles with max speed 45 km/h |
| A1 | Light motorcycle | 16 | Engine approximately 125cc, power up to 11kW |
| A | Bike | 20 | Progressive access from A1 |
| B | Guest vehicle | 18 | Automobiles as much as 3500kg with up to 8 travelers |
| BE | Automobile with trailer | 18 | B lorry with trailer over 750kg |
| C1 | Light truck | 18 | Vehicles 3500-7500kg |
| C | Heavy truck | 21 | Cars over 3500kg |
| D1 | Small bus | 21 | As much as 16 passengers |
| D | Bus | 24 | Over 8 guests |
The classification B license represents the most frequently sought-after certification, as it covers regular automobile and supplies the best flexibility for everyday transportation needs. Those requiring permission for bikes, business lorries, or vehicles with trailers need to pursue additional categories following the completion of their initial license.
Cost Breakdown and Financial Considerations
The total cost of acquiring a Swedish driving license varies significantly depending upon private ability, the driving school picked, and the variety of lessons required. Nevertheless, comprehending the normal expenditure structure assists prospects budget plan properly.
| Cost Item | Estimated Cost (SEK) | Notes |
|---|---|---|
| Student's permit application | 150-300 | Includes picture and processing |
| Medical exam | 200-400 | Authorized healthcare company |
| Driving school enrollment | 500-1,500 | Registration and initial assessment |
| Mandatory theory lessons | 1,500-2,500 | Normally 8-12 lessons required |
| Obligatory driving lessons | 4,000-6,500 | Includes numerous driving conditions |
| Optional extra lessons | 500-800 each | Differs by individual requirement |
| Theory examination | 325 | Computer-based test at assessment center |
| Practical driving test | 800-1,100 | Consists of car rental if needed |
| License issuance cost | 200-400 | Picture card production |
Typically, candidates ought to anticipate to invest between 10,000 and 15,000 Swedish kronor for a category B license, though those requiring substantial extra practice might find costs surpassing 20,000 kronor. Frequently Asked Questions
Can I exchange my foreign driving license for a Swedish one?
Individuals having valid driving licenses from EU/EEA nations can generally exchange them for Swedish licenses without undergoing testing. Those with licenses from non-EU/EEA countries might need to complete theory and useful tests, though some nations have mutual contracts that streamline the procedure. The Transport Agency supplies specific assistance based upon the country of origin.
The length of time is the Swedish driving license valid?
A Swedish driving license is normally legitimate up until the holder reaches seventy years of age. After this point, license renewal is required every five years, with medical checkups essential for certain classifications. For holders of commercial licenses, more regular medical assessments may be required no matter age.
What takes place if I fail the driving test?
Candidates who stop working either the theoretical or practical evaluation may retake the test after waiting a minimum period, which is generally 2 weeks. There is no limit on the variety of efforts, though each effort sustains additional costs. Numerous instructors recommend additional practice lessons following an unsuccessful effort to deal with determined weak points.
